.elementor-41949 .elementor-element.elementor-element-d50eb48{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;border-style:none;--border-style:none;--padding-top:5px;--padding-bottom:5px;--padding-left:5px;--padding-right:5px;}.elementor-widget-shortcode .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-shortcode .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-41949 .elementor-element.elementor-element-f7c98c4 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-widget-jet-listing-dynamic-image .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-jet-listing-dynamic-image .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-41949 .elementor-element.elementor-element-9b9fdf7 .jet-listing-dynamic-image{justify-content:flex-start;}.elementor-41949 .elementor-element.elementor-element-9b9fdf7 .jet-listing-dynamic-image__figure{align-items:flex-start;}.elementor-41949 .elementor-element.elementor-element-9b9fdf7 .jet-listing-dynamic-image a{display:flex;justify-content:flex-start;}.elementor-41949 .elementor-element.elementor-element-9b9fdf7 .jet-listing-dynamic-image__caption{text-align:left;}.elementor-widget-woocommerce-product-title .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-woocommerce-product-title .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-woocommerce-product-title .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-41949 .elementor-element.elementor-element-c6f2df1{text-align:center;}.elementor-41949 .elementor-element.elementor-element-c6f2df1 .elementor-heading-title{font-family:"Poppins", Sans-serif;font-size:15px;font-weight:500;color:#54595F;}.elementor-widget-jet-woo-builder-archive-add-to-cart .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-jet-woo-builder-archive-add-to-cart .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-41949 .elementor-element.elementor-element-2f694eb .jet-woo-builder-archive-add-to-cart .button{display:inline-block;--display-type:inline-block;color:var( --e-global-color-131c25e );background-color:var( --e-global-color-primary );padding:10px 20px 10px 20px;}.elementor-41949 .elementor-element.elementor-element-2f694eb .jet-woo-builder-archive-add-to-cart{text-align:center;}@media(max-width:767px){.elementor-41949 .elementor-element.elementor-element-d50eb48{--justify-content:space-between;--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-41949 .elementor-element.elementor-element-c6f2df1 .elementor-heading-title{font-size:12px;}}/* Start custom CSS for shortcode, class: .elementor-element-f7c98c4 */.yith-wcwl-add-button a.add_to_wishlist {
        font-size: 0; /* Hide the text */
    }

    
    .yith-wcwl-add-button a.add_to_wishlist i.yith-wcwl-icon {
        font-size: 20px; /* Adjust the font size of the heart icon */
        color:#248A8D;
    }
    
    
.yith-wcwl-add-button{
    position: relative;
    top: 50px;
    left: 75%;
    z-index: 1;

}


@media screen and (max-width: 425px) {
  .yith-wcwl-add-button{
    position: absolute;
    top: 30px;
    left: 80%;
    z-index: 1;

}
}

/* Hide the text inside the .feedback span */
    .yith-wcwl-add-button .feedback {
        display: none;
    }
    
    
    .move_to_another_wishlist{
        font-size: 0;
    }
    
    /* Adjust the filled heart icon style */
    .yith-wcwl-add-button .yith-wcwl-icon.fa-heart {
        font-size: 20px; /* Adjust the size of the heart icon */
        color: #248A8D; /* Change the color to red or your preferred color */
        margin-right: 5px; /* Add some space between the icon and other elements */
    }
    
    
    .elementor-41949 .elementor-element.elementor-element-f7c98c4{
        height: 0px !important;
    }/* End custom CSS */